As a new contractor, please read this before scheduling audit runs. The color-contrast scanner crawls every themed surface in the Brindlewood design system and computes contrast ratios per component state, so run cost grows roughly with theme count times viewport count. Batch runs overnight; daytime runs are reserved for spot checks. Concurrency, page budgets, and ratio thresholds were calibrated during the Fallowgate redesign and must be changed together. The current tuning constants are listed below.

constants for hahip-hafog:
WEIGHTS = {
    "feniel": 55,
    "kasox": 667,
}

This runbook covers restarting the Echotrail audio-guide backend used at the Pellworth Gallery. If tour playback stalls, first check the sync worker logs, then restart the service with the standard script. Before the service will boot, its environment file must include the media-token entry. Open /etc/echotrail/env and confirm the following line is present:

env line for fafof-fahag: LEDGER_TOKEN5=f8790

# Limits & Quotas: Dark Mode (Greywick Admin)

Dark-mode support in the Greywick admin dashboard ships behind a per-tenant flag. Theme assets are generated at build time; runtime palette overrides are rate-limited to avoid cache thrash on the style endpoint. Custom palettes are capped per tenant, and preview sessions expire quickly. Don't bump the override quota without checking CDN purge costs with the Inkshore team first. Current limits are enforced by the constants listed here.

limits module of yadug-tawip:
QUOTAS = {
    "julael": 705,
    "kasael": 903,
    "druwyn": 489,
}

## Local Setup — Timezone Handling in Report Exports

The Quivertide export service converts all stored UTC timestamps into the requesting account's timezone at render time. To verify conversions locally, seed the sample reports database and run the export job with a non-UTC test account. Before running the seeder, point your local environment at the sample database using the following connection string.

replica DSN, yahaf-yagaf: mongodb://tamath_svc:a2netSk3RZMuTj@db-d084.novacsoft.internal:5432/ralmir